Technical Summary

From a technical standpoint, the incidents reveal shortcomings in smart contract logic and the architecture of decentralized applications. It highlights the urgent need for more robust security audits, rigorous testing protocols, and better implementation of decentralized governance mechanisms to minimize exploitative vulnerabilities. Innovations such as formal verification methods and on-chain security protocols may gain traction as developers strive to fortify their applications against future threats.
